You forgot to mention about the Class Halls, mostly. Like, while doing any WQ, on the Broken Shore, Legion Invasions , or others, it is important that the character chooses his all-time bodyguard champion, and put the Order Resource/Gold equipment. They'll end up with more resource they can handle and spare the main character of using them, or even by playing with one with those equips on the main, you can progress thru the AK up to 50 with him, then with the Big extra Order resources you can buy 1-12 of the compendiums, costing a total of 1-12k order resources, and giving your alts a huge catch-up system, they will instantly get AK45, spering them from using their own (and scarse) resources for other things, like their own order halls research (lvl 7 and 8, for 25k total, each, for example). Blizz has many tools to improve Alts playing in Legion, just people not using them properly it seems, then come in forums whine at Legion not being alt friendly haha.Also, there are some champions like Meatball, that any class can have in their class hall, and has huge bonus to eitheir mission farming, or bodyguard role, and he's easy to get, since you can now get enough ilvl in 7.2 to at least beat the first boss of the brawler's guild with ease (or repeat him for some of the class hall missions that spawn on his questline).
Also, take advantage of the Invasions. You might be able to only do the first 6 WQ's that are up, but, depending on what you end up getting, xp or artifact power, it will drastically speed up leveling for your alt. I leveled a 100 Mage to 110, on 7 invasions and 1 dungeon at the end because I didn't want to wait a day, and also ended up with 10 points into my Artifact. Happy Alt'ing.

You can likey update the "If you already have a well-progressed main character with Artifact Knowledge 25, purchase Artifact Research Compendium: Volumes I-IV in your Order Hall for 1000 and send it to your alt. They can then use the book to reach AK 20 instantly. Then complete 5 Knowledge is Power to reach AK 25." bit, as it progresses upwards, likely through AK 50 (on my AK 31 Main, I was able to buy "Artifact Research Compendium: Volumes I-V" which gave my fresh 110 AK 25.
